What Is Agentic AI and Why It Matters

Agentic AI refers to systems designed to operate with a degree of autonomy. Unlike traditional AI models that respond to specific prompts, agentic systems can:

  • Set goals and break them into actionable steps

  • Execute tasks across multiple platforms

  • Learn from feedback and improve performance

  • Adapt to changing conditions in real time

In simple terms, these systems function more like digital operators rather than passive tools. They can handle entire workflows—from data collection to execution—without constant human input.

This capability is redefining how work is structured and delivered across industries.

From Assistance to Autonomy

The transition from traditional AI to agentic AI represents a shift from assistance to autonomy.

Earlier AI systems were designed to:

  • Answer questions

  • Generate text or images

  • Provide recommendations

Agentic AI, on the other hand, can:

  • Manage end-to-end business processes

  • Coordinate tasks across different systems

  • Make context-aware decisions

  • Deliver measurable outcomes

For example, an agentic system in a business environment could analyze market data, create a strategy, execute campaigns, and monitor performance—all with minimal supervision.

This level of capability is why organizations are investing heavily in this next generation of AI.

Real-World Applications of Agentic AI

Agentic AI is already being explored across multiple sectors, with promising results.

Some key applications include:

  • Business Operations: Automating workflows such as reporting, scheduling, and process optimization

  • Finance: Managing portfolios, assessing risks, and generating insights

  • Customer Experience: Handling end-to-end customer journeys, from inquiry to resolution

  • Software Development: Writing, testing, and deploying code autonomously

These applications demonstrate how agentic AI can move beyond isolated tasks to drive entire systems and processes.

Challenges and Considerations

As powerful as agentic AI is, it also brings new challenges that must be addressed.

Key concerns include:

  • Control and Oversight: Ensuring that autonomous systems operate within defined boundaries

  • Data Security: Protecting sensitive information used by AI systems

  • Ethical Use: Preventing misuse or unintended consequences

  • Reliability: Ensuring consistent and accurate performance

Understanding these challenges is essential for anyone working with agentic AI. Proper training and awareness can help mitigate risks and ensure responsible implementation.
